Punjabi UK-Style

Ahmed Ali Butt is going places, make no mistake. After doing a string of successful Pakistani films in which he played important characters (and funny ones too), the actor has been roped in for a UK-based Punjabi film titled Phatte Dinde Chakk Punjabi. His co-artists in the project, for which shooting has already begun, are Annu Kapoor, Gippy Grewal and Neeru Bajwa. The movie is set to release on Eid-ul-Azha next year. Way to go Butt sahib, chak de UK de phatte!

Deepa’s Pakistanis

Critically acclaimed director Deepa Mehta’s film Funny Boy has been announced as Canada’s official entry for the Best International Feature Film Category at the 93rd Academy Awards, to be held in the first quarter of 2021. We are proud that two of Pakistan’s young filmmakers Meher Jaffri and Ali Kazmi are part of the project which was shot in Sri Lanka. While Meher J has representation on the behind-the-scenes crew, the latter has a pretty substantial role in the movie. He plays the father of the Sri Lankan lead kid and even learnt Sinhala and Tamil for the role. Cool, na?

Namak Halaal Redux

Namak Halaal is one of the most commercially successful films of Amitabh Bachhan’s career. Apart from an interesting plotline and good acting by all actors in it (Shashi Kapoor and Smita Patel), its foot-tapping music composed by Bappi Lahiri contributed substantially to the success of the 1982 blockbuster. News is that a producer by the name of Murad Khetani has bought the rights to the film and intends to make its 21st century version. Bappi da is not happy about it because, he says, “no one has approached me so I don’t know what the plans are.” Well, sir, perhaps their plan is not to approach you?
